Stock markets brace for volatility amid US tariffs, inflation data, and RBI rate decision, following Trump’s tariff announcements.

Volatility is anticipated in the Indian stock markets this week as investors keep a close watch on the repercussions of US tariffs, US inflation figures, and the Reserve Bank of India’s (RBI) interest rate verdict. The recent tariff pronouncements by US President Donald Trump have sparked worries about a probable trade conflict and inflationary strains. Market movements will be swayed by significant economic data disclosures and the RBI’s stance on interest rates.
